Thomas Delmer "Artimus" Pyle (born July 15, 1948)[2] is an American musician who played drums with the southern rock band Lynyrd Skynyrd from 1974 to 1977 and from 1987 to 1991. He and his bandmates were inducted into the Rock and Roll Hall of Fame in 2006.[3][4]
